What Are Finned Tubes?

Finned Tubes are specialized heat transfer tubes that feature extended surface fins attached to the outer surface of a base tube. The base tube is typically manufactured from carbon steel, stainless steel, copper alloys, or other high-grade metals depending on application requirements. The fins are either integrally formed from the base material or mechanically bonded, welded, or extruded to ensure strong metallurgical adhesion and thermal conductivity.

From a metallurgical perspective, the base materials are selected for strength, corrosion resistance, and thermal stability. Stainless steel finned tubes offer excellent resistance to oxidation and high-temperature scaling, while carbon steel variants provide structural strength and cost efficiency. Copper alloy finned tubes deliver superior thermal conductivity for refrigeration and HVAC systems. These tubes are engineered to withstand internal pressure, temperature fluctuations, and corrosive industrial atmospheres. Their enhanced surface area significantly improves convective heat transfer performance, reducing energy consumption and optimizing process efficiency.

Advantages of Finned Tubes?

Finned Tubes provide a distinct advantage in thermal management systems due to their ability to transfer heat more efficiently than plain tubes. By increasing external surface area, they improve heat exchange rates without requiring larger equipment footprints. This makes them ideal for compact industrial systems where space optimization is essential.

In terms of mechanical performance, finned tubes exhibit strong structural integrity and resistance to vibration and thermal stress. Materials such as stainless steel and alloy steel enhance durability and extend operational life in harsh environments. Corrosion resistance is another major benefit, particularly in chemical processing plants and offshore installations where exposure to moisture, chemicals, and temperature extremes is common.

Machinability and fabrication flexibility allow seamless integration with industrial piping systems, pressure vessels, and structural frameworks. Whether used alongside stainless steel bars, seamless pipes, or heavy plates, finned tubes maintain dimensional stability and compatibility. Their long-term performance reduces maintenance costs, improves energy efficiency, and ensures cost-effective lifecycle operation.

Finned Tubes manufactured by Super Metalloys are produced in compliance with recognized standards such as ASTM A179 and ASTM A192 for seamless carbon steel heat exchanger tubes, ASTM A213 for stainless steel boiler and superheater tubes, and ASTM A210 for medium carbon steel boiler tubes. ASME specifications correspond to these ASTM grades for use in pressure equipment and high-temperature service conditions. These standards define chemical composition, tensile strength, hardness, dimensional tolerances, and hydrostatic testing requirements. Compliance ensures reliability, traceability, and performance integrity in critical industrial operations.

Steel and metal products including bars, pipes, tubes, plates, sheets, and coils are classified under global standards such as ASTM and ASME in North America, EN and DIN in Europe, JIS in Japan, and ISO for international harmonization. Each standard defines grade designation based on chemical composition, mechanical properties, heat treatment condition, and application suitability. For example, stainless steel tubes for heat exchangers may carry specific grade markings that indicate chromium and nickel content, while carbon steel plates for pressure vessels are identified by minimum yield strength. This standardized naming system enables engineers, procurement managers, and fabricators to select appropriate materials for structural engineering, industrial fabrication, and process piping systems with confidence.
